Ellis Wilson (American/Kentucky, 1899-1977), "Girls with Kites", oil on masonite, signed lower right, signed en verso, 7 in. x 8 in., framed.

  • Notes: Note: In the early 1950s, the African American artist, Ellis Wilson began to make trips to the island community of Haiti. The daily activities, lively markets and unique cultural traditions of the island fascinated Wilson. Influenced by the artistic heritage of Haiti, Wilson began to paint in a more stylized way, with silhouetted flat figures and bright lively colors. This charming painting, set in a lush tropical green setting, depicts four young girls in simple colorful dresses each with their own kite.
